The global race for Artificial Intelligence leadership is becoming increasingly competitive. Countries, corporations, universities, and startups are investing billions of dollars to secure advantages in AI research and development. This competition is creating unprecedented demand for advanced computing infrastructure.
NVIDIA occupies a strategic position within this environment. The company supplies technologies that support AI training, machine learning deployment, scientific simulations, cloud services, and advanced analytics.
One important trend often overlooked by investors is sovereign AI development. Governments around the world are investing in domestic computing capacity to support national technology objectives. These initiatives require substantial hardware infrastructure, creating additional demand drivers beyond commercial markets.
At the same time, industries such as healthcare, biotechnology, climate research, financial services, and defense continue expanding their use of AI-powered solutions.
The result is a broad and diversified demand base supporting long-term growth opportunities.
While market volatility may create short-term fluctuations, the underlying drivers behind AI infrastructure investment remain strong. As organizations continue digitizing operations and adopting intelligent systems, companies supplying the necessary computing power could remain central beneficiaries.
NVIDIA's role in this transformation explains why it continues attracting attention from investors seeking exposure to some of the most important technological trends shaping the future.
